About Me
As a gay man myself, I deeply understand the significance of creating a space that is not just accepting but affirming of all identities and experiences. My approach is rooted in compassion and centred around building a safe environment to foster self-discovery, resilience, and meaningful change. I specialize in navigating relationship issues, emotional challenges, meaning, and self-worth, with a gentle focus on understanding and transforming the underlying causes of distress. I offer non-judgmental therapy to adults from various diverse backgrounds and life experiences dealing with challenges like anxiety, addiction, depression, relationship issues, trauma, identity, and existential concerns. My therapeutic approach incorporates evidence-based methods, focusing on helping clients understand the factors shaping their behaviors and changing unhelpful patterns.
